IT'S raining again. The raindrops are tapping on my window pane, urging me to get up and enjoy the cold. But I AM enjoying the cold under the sheets. The chill takes no for an answer, and before I know it, I'm at the breakfast table, eating hot champorado with tuyo flakes stirred in. And I'm happy. The grey sky outside no longer looks dreary, as my hot chocolate rice porridge warms my belly and my spirit. Happy food.
It's hot on a Sunday afternoon. Way too hot. The sun seems to penetrate every nook and cranny of our home. A refresher is in order. The freezer is opened, and out comes tubes of ice candy. I had frozen them the night before, in case of heated emergencies like this. Avocado was mashed, milk and sugar mixed in, then funneled into ice bags, their tops twisted in tight knots. Frozen overnight, a delight the next day. We feast on the avocado ice candy. The chill comforts us, and the sun is forgotten. Happy food.
It's getting too complicated at work. The paperwork has piled up and the meetings are overlapping. The need to simplify is getting intense, and home is the best place to get it. I take out a bag of pan de sal and a can of condensed milk. Each bread is torn open, then drizzled with the sweet, sweet milk. I bite into one condensed milk sandwich and sigh. I am a kid again. Life is simple. Life is sweet. It's not as complicated as we think it is. The soft and crusty texture of the pan de sal complemented by the gooeyness of the milk assures me all will be good. Happy food.
There are certain foods that we associate with comfort and happiness. These three are mine. What's your happy food?
